본문 바로가기
Web Service/React

[Next.js] Vercel 오류 및 Next.js 구조

by junnykim 2022. 3. 19.

Next.js로 프로젝트를 만든 후에 Vercel로 배포하려고 했는데 계속 에러가 났다...

아직도 생각하면 잠이 안오는...^^

npm run dev로 하면 local로는 열리는데, 배포할 때 오류가 생겼다.

구글링해서 하라는 거 다 했는데도 되지 않아서 왜지? 싶었다.

고치려고 노력했으나 되지 않았고, 그냥 무시하고 진행했다.

 

그러다가 오늘 할 거 다 해서, 다시 한번 시도했는데, 드디어 에러를 해결했다.

정말 간단한 실수때문에 일어난 일이었는데, 헛짓거리를 했기에

나같은 사람이 다시 없길 하는 바람에서 글을 작성한다.

~intro는 여기까지~

 

 

npm run build --prod

명령어 입력하면, 어디서 오류가 났는지 알려주고, 친히 링크까지 알려준다.

링크들어가서 오류 해결하는게 제일 빠른 방법

 

 

page-without-valid-component | Next.js (nextjs.org)

 

page-without-valid-component | Next.js

Page Without Valid React Component A page that does not export a valid React Component was found while analyzing the build output. This is a hard error because the page would error when rendered, and causes poor build performance. Investigate the list of p

nextjs.org

내가 index빼고 모두 components 파일안에 넣어뒀는데,

Next.js는 어디에 뭘 넣어야 하는지 대충 정해져 있었다는 것을

이번에 깨닫게 되었다.

~그래서 Next.js의 기본적인 구조를 정리하고자 한다~

 

 

댓글